Home window install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ing windows in residential properties to improve their app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ency. This process typically includes removing old, damaged, or outdated windows and installing new ones that better suit the style and needs of the home. Local contractors use a variety of window styles and materials to match the property's architecture and the homeowner’s preferences, ensuring a seamless fit and finish. Proper installation is essential to prevent drafts, leaks, and other issues that can arise from poorly fitted windows, making this service a practical choice for homeowners seeking a professional upgrade.

Many homeowners turn to window installation services when faced with problems such as drafty windows, difficulty opening or closing, or visible damage like cracks and warping. Over time, windows can become less effective at insulating a home, leading to increased energy bills and reduced comfort. Additionally, older windows may no longer meet safety standards or provide adequate security. Replacing windows can help address these issues by enhancing insulation, improving security, and updating the overall look of a property. The overview below groups typical Home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ann Arbor, MI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Ann Arbor range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ering tasks like replacing a single window or fixing minor issues.

Standard Window Replacement - Full replacement of standard-sized windows gener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Local contractors often handle these projects with most falling into the $1,500-$2,500 range depending on the window style and materials.

Large or Custom Windows - Installing larger or custom-designed windows can cost $3,500-$7,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to push into higher cost brackets due to specialized materials and installation requirements.

Full Home Window Upgrade - Complete window upgrade for an entire home in the Ann Arbor area typically ranges from $10,000 to $30,000. While many projects stay within the middle of this range, larger, more complex upgrades can exceed $30,000 depending on the number and type of windows.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ear, written expectations are essential when comparing local service providers. Homeowners should seek out contractors who provide detailed project descriptions, including the scope of work, materials to be used, and any specific procedures or standards they follow.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. It’s also beneficial to review any written estimates or proposals to ensure they align with the homeowner’s goals and to clarify what is included and what might incur additional costs.

What types of windows can local contractors install? Local service providers can typically install a variety of window styles, including double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ows, to suit different needs and preferences.

Do home window installation services include removal of old windows? Yes, most local contractors handle the removal of existing windows as part of the installation process to ensure proper fitting and function of the new units.

Are there options for energy-efficient window installations? Many local service providers offer energy-efficient window options that can help improve insulation and reduce energy costs, depending on the products available in the area.

Can local contractors customize window sizes for unique openings? Yes, experienced local pros can often customize window sizes or provide special ordering options to fit non-standard or custom-sized openings.
